 Firstly this is not the place to go if you want an on-site bar, playground for the kids, or free wi-fi. In my opinion it’s all the better for not having those “attractions”. The campsite is most definitely Eco - there are very few amenities apart from the basics of running water and toilets.

The site is in a beautiful setting in a valley surrounded by trees, bursting with wildlife of all kinds. There are pleasant walks to be had directly from the campsite, through woods, fields and farmland, with the added attraction of two pubs both no more than 40 minutes walk away. We visited the Six Bells in Chiddingly and can recommend it for its friendly welcome and excellent, reasonably priced, food.

The staff at the campsite were very helpful, and went out of their way to get the boiler going so we could all have hot showers (in the open-to-the-skies wooden shower cubicle). They also sold us enough wood to get a campfire going.

The two compost toilets were clean and hygienic - just throw some sawdust in if you’ve done a poo!

There are some recycling bins provided but to be honest the site does look quite ramshackle and in need of some TLC. Despite that we had a lovely weekend and would definitely go there again, hopefully with better weather next time!

 Merrylands is a great place I absolutely live it there, the owners Maggie & Sean are so friendly & are great people!

I have been going there for about 13 years now, at the beginning just with my good friends & now with all our kids & they love it,

It's got a nice healthy stream running through, 2 great pubs within walking distance, echo shower & toilets which are great but could maybe do with a couple more!, fires allowed which is great for cooking & keeping warm at night!

Truly a great place & will always go back for as long as possible. The prices are great only pay per adult, fire wood great value at 20 good size logs for £5.

Little farmers type shop a little drive down land & village near by wicked tesco & restaurants etc. Beach not to far away.

 This is a beautiful site that is focussed on low-impact, green living, is full of wildlife, and has brilliant eco-friendly facilities such as a hot showers heated by a wood burner.

The owners are lovely, always on hand to help, and I always feel very lucky to be able to stay here!
